Cat trees, also known as cat condos or kitty towers, are essential pieces of furniture for cat parents. These structures offer a ton of benefits, ranging from physical exercise and mental stimulation to providing a safe space for climbing, scratching, and lounging. As indoor pets, cats rely on their environment for enrichment, and cat trees serve as miniature playgrounds that mimic their natural habitat. But which cat tree is right for you?
